Famous for its colourful market and for dog racing at Walthamstow Stadium, this up- and-coming area is full of character and is popular with first time buyers and city workers. Walthamstow is in the midst of a regeneration programme, with funding from the government and further investment coming from the public and private sectors. The area has a good supply of amenities and is well served by public transport and is in postcode E17 in the London Borough of Waltham Forest. People searching for property in Walthamstow will be able to choose from Victorian and Edwardian terraced houses, cottages and modern low-rise blocks of flats. Amenities for properties in Walthamstow

Walthamstow's High Street is dominated by the street market which contains over 400 stalls and claims to be Europe's longest at 1km. For more shopping residents can browse the 300 shops that are concentrated in the Selborne Centre and along the High Street and Hoe Street, where you can buy everything you need from clothing to groceries. People who are searching for a property in Walthamstow will discover a huge range of genuine character pubs and a good selection of restaurants in the area. Other attractions in E17 include dog racing at Walthamstow Stadium, the William Morris Museum, Vestry House Museum, Walthamstow Village Conservation Area and Lloyd Park. Lloyd Park has ornamental gardens, a scented garden for the visually impaired, an aviary, café, skating rink and sports area.

Transport for Walthamstow

If you're looking for property in Walthamstow and a fast efficient link to the West End and Central London is important, then look no further. E17 has two overground railway stations at Walthamstow Central and Blackhorse Road of which both provide access to the Victoria Line (Zone 3). The town has a good selection of bus routes running from the third busiest bus station in London: the main routes are to the station at London Bridge, Chingford, Leyton and London City Airport.
